[0034] The preferred embodiments of the present invention are described in detail as follows:
[0035] see Figure 1 ~ Figure 3 , which is based on JPEG lossless compression of OPEN-EXR images, the specific steps are as follows:
[0036] (1) The source OPEN-EXR image used is a 16bit RGB image, and the image size of each color channel is 512x512. Take the R channel as an example (others are the same), move each pixel according to the raster scan order, and read each pixel value P i The floating-point value of .
[0037] (2) The displayed image can only display the range from 0 to 1. If it is less than 0, it will be completely black by default, and if it is greater than 1, it will be completely white by default. Therefore, we change the floating-point value as shown in formula (2-1), and convert the 16-bit floating-point value into an 8-bit integer value.
